ttyrex

ttyrec with more options
git clone https://a3nm.net/git/ttyrex/
Log | Files | Refs | README

ttyplay.1 (1293B)


      1 .\"
      2 .\" This manual page is written by NAKANO Takeo <nakano@webmasters.gr.jp>
      3 .\"
      4 .TH TTYPLAY 1
      5 .SH NAME
      6 ttyplay \- player of the tty session recorded by ttyrec
      7 .SH SYNOPSIS
      8 .br
      9 .B ttyplay
     10 .I [\-s SPEED] [\-j] [\-n] [\-p] file
     11 .br
     12 .SH DESCRIPTION
     13 .B Ttyplay
     14 plays the tty session in
     15 .IR file ,
     16 which was recorded previously by
     17 .BR ttyrec (1).
     18 .PP
     19 When
     20 .B \-p
     21 option is given,
     22 .B ttyplay
     23 output the
     24 .I file
     25 as it grows.
     26 It means that you can see the "live" shell session 
     27 running by another user.
     28 .PP
     29 If you hit any key during playback, it will go right to the next
     30 character typed.  This is handy when examining sessions where a user
     31 spends a lot of time at a prompt.
     32 .PP
     33 Additionally, there are some special keys defined:
     34 .TP
     35 .BI + " or " f
     36  double the speed of playback.
     37 .TP
     38 .BI \- " or " s
     39  halve the speed of playback.
     40 .TP
     41 .BI 0
     42 set playback speed to 0, pausing playback.
     43 .TP
     44 .BI 1
     45 set playback to speed 1.0 again.
     46 
     47 .SH OPTIONS
     48 .TP
     49 .BI \-s " SPEED"
     50 multiple the playing speed by
     51 .I SPEED
     52 (default is 1).
     53 .TP
     54 .BI \-j " TIMESTAMP"
     55 run in no wait mode until reaching
     56 .I TIMESTAMP
     57 and then revert to normal speed.
     58 .TP
     59 .B \-n
     60 no wait mode.
     61 Ignore the timing information in
     62 .IR file .
     63 .TP
     64 .B \-p
     65 peek another person's tty session.
     66 .SH "SEE ALSO"
     67 .BR script (1),
     68 .BR ttyrec (1),
     69 .BR ttytime (1)
     70